Product Overview

The MCP1603T-150I/OS belongs to the category of voltage regulators and is commonly used in electronic devices to provide a stable output voltage. Its characteristics include high efficiency, compact package, and low quiescent current. The essence of this product lies in its ability to efficiently regulate voltage while minimizing power loss. The MCP1603T-150I/OS is typically available in small surface-mount packages and is sold in various quantities.

Specifications

  • Input Voltage Range: 2.7V to 5.5V
  • Output Voltage: 1.5V
  • Maximum Output Current: 500mA
  • Operating Temperature Range: -40°C to 125°C
  • Package Type: SOT-23

Working Principles

The MCP1603T-150I/OS operates on the principle of pulse-width modulation (PWM) to regulate the output voltage. It uses an internal oscillator to control the duty cycle and maintain the desired output voltage.
